"I made a 'sex to-do list.'" Vertical Entertainment has unveiled the official trailer for a spunky sex comedy titled A Nice Girl Like You, adapted from the book titled "Pornology" by Ayn Carrillo. This stars Lucy Hale as a Harvard grad who is dumped by her boyfriend for being too "pornophobic." The film follows her hilarious explorations facing her sexual fears after she decides to learn about all she hasn't yet experienced. Also stars Mindy Cohn, Leonidas Gulaptis, Adhir Kalyan, Stephen Friedrich, Skye P. Marshall, Leah McKendrick, Jina Panebianco, Nadia Quinn, and Jackie Cruz. Lillias White, Annie Golden, T. Oliver Reid, Lady Rizo, Vivian Reed, and Nadia Quinn amp Ahna O'Reilly with the Playbillies will join the previously announced headliners Alice Ripley, Nathan Lee Graham, Gay Marshall, Carol Lipnik, Rob Maitner and Gabrielle Stravelli for the sixth annual Night Of A Thousand Judys - the Pride concert to benefit The Ali Forney Center presented by The Meeting hosted by Justin Sayre. The event will take place at Merkin Concert Hall at the Kaufman Center 129 West 67th Street in Manhattan on Monday, June 6.

Roundabout Theatre Company, in association with Daryl Roth Productions, justannouncedthe full cast joining Steven Pasquale in the first-ever New York revival of Alfred Uhry and Robert Waldman's musical comedy The Robber Bridegroom. Joining the previously announced Steven Pasquale as Jamie Lockhart is Andrew Durand as Little Harp, Evan Harrington as Big Harp, Greg Hildreth as Goat, Leslie Kritzer as Salome, Ahna O'Reilly as Rosamund, Nadia Quinn as RavenGoat's Mother, Lance Roberts as Clement Musgrove and Devere Rogers as AirieMan.
